How they compare
Italy currently reports 17,209 Thousand persons against 12,169 Thousand persons in Poland, a difference of 5,040 Thousand persons.
That makes Italy's figure about 1.4 times Poland's.
Across all 12 years both countries report, Italy has been ahead every year.
Italy ranks 5th and Poland ranks 7th of 40 countries.
Italy has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Italy | Poland |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 14,537 Thousand persons | 10,949 Thousand persons | 3,588 Thousand persons | Italy |
| 2000s | 16,183 Thousand persons | 10,671 Thousand persons | 5,512 Thousand persons | Italy |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
